Alaska Airlines will increase the number of its flights between Southern California and the Bay Area from six to 23 on Oct. 1 . . . Singer Co. announced that it has moved its principal executive offices to Montvale, N.J., from Stamford, Conn. . . . The Investment Company Institute reported that the assets of the nation’s 393 money-market mutual funds rose $1.86 billion in the week ended Aug. 19 . . . Several firms led by Gabelli Group said they dropped a $238-million takeover bid for Di Giorgio Corp., a San Francisco-based food packer and distributor . . . Coca-Cola Co. may buy a minority share in Viacom Inc. . . . The Chicago Board of Trade will launch day and evening trading in new gold and silver contracts on Sept. 13.
